What companies run services between Chambers St, NY, USA and Port Authority Bus Terminal, NY, USA?

MTA New York City Transit operates a subway from Chambers St to 42 St-Port Authority Bus Terminal every 5 minutes, and the journey takes 14 min. Alternatively, MTA Bus Company operates a bus from Harrison St/Hudson St to 8 Av/W 37 St every 30 minutes. Tickets cost $2–7 and the journey takes 31 min.
